Jenis Data Mata Wang dalam Postgres: Numeric vs. Float
Walaupun tuntutan lapuk mencadangkan sebaliknya, jenis data Wang kekal sebagai pilihan yang sah untuk menyimpan mata wang dalam PostgreSQL. Walau bagaimanapun, untuk kebanyakan aplikasi, jenis data Numerik (juga dikenali sebagai Perpuluhan) disyorkan.
Numeric vs. Float
Numeric memberikan ketepatan yang lebih tinggi daripada Float, menjadikannya lebih sesuai untuk pengiraan kewangan. Float boleh memperkenalkan ralat pembundaran, yang boleh menjadi ketara dalam konteks kewangan.
Wang lwn. Numerik
Walaupun jenis Wang mempunyai kelebihan prestasi tertentu, adalah dinasihatkan untuk mengelakkan ia kecuali dalam kes penggunaan tertentu. Numeric menawarkan faedah berikut:
Integer untuk Sen
Jika sen pecahan tidak ditemui, menyimpan mata wang sebagai Integer yang mewakili Sen boleh menjadi pilihan yang cekap. Pendekatan ini menghapuskan keperluan untuk pengiraan titik terapung dan meningkatkan prestasi.
Kesimpulan:
Untuk kebanyakan aplikasi, jenis data Numerik ialah pilihan yang disyorkan untuk menyimpan mata wang dalam PostgreSQL. Ketepatan tinggi dan penerimaan industri menjadikannya pilihan yang paling sesuai untuk pengiraan kewangan dan penyimpanan data.
Atas ialah kandungan terperinci Numerik, Wang atau Integer: Jenis Data PostgreSQL manakah yang Terbaik untuk Mata Wang?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!